dpbjinc posted:Heads up: the uBlock developer has changed. You may need to reinstall the extension to get updates. The new repository is https://github.com/chrisaljoudi/uBlock. The new developer is asking for donations for the project. The last developer didn't ask for donations expressly so he could cut bait if the general public or some other aspect of the project became too much to deal with. We don't know if he was prescient or just knew himself well. Really the most worrying change is that uBlock doesn't really have a Firefox guy anymore. (EDIT: They got a guy. I'm not sure there's anything to worry about at this point.) dont be mean to me fucked around with this message at 21:01 on Apr 3, 2015 |
# ? Apr 3, 2015 20:43 |
|
Sir Unimaginative posted:The last developer didn't ask for donations expressly so he could cut bait if the general public or some other aspect of the project became too much to deal with. We don't know if he was prescient or just knew himself well. Here is what Raymond(former dev) has just said in the support section for ublock on the Google store "Yes. But I will keep maintaining my own version here. Roughly I consider uBlock feature-complete, and my goal is to keep it working just fine, ensuring it keeps working flawlessly on Chromium-based browser. Both versions will likely diverge eventually." So it looks like he intends to do bug fixes for chrome only from now on.
